Epipremnum Pinnatum Albo Variegated Cebu Blue


Watering
This plant prefers a consistent watering schedule. It thrives when the top inch of its soil is allowed to dry out between waterings. Overwatering can lead to root rot, so it’s essential to avoid letting the plant sit in waterlogged soil. Water more frequently during the growing season (spring and summer) and reduce watering during the cooler months.

Light
Bright, indirect light is ideal for the Epipremnum Pinnatum Albo Variegated Cebu Blue. While it can tolerate lower light conditions, insufficient light may cause the variegation to fade. Direct sunlight should be avoided as it can scorch the delicate leaves, especially the variegated sections.

Temperature
This tropical plant thrives in temperatures between 65-85°F (18-29°C). It is sensitive to cold drafts and should be kept away from air conditioning vents or open windows during colder months. Consistent warmth will encourage healthy growth and vibrant foliage.

Soil Mix
A well-draining soil mix is crucial for the health of this plant. A mix containing peat moss, perlite, and orchid bark will provide the necessary aeration and drainage. This combination ensures that the roots do not stay overly moist, preventing root rot.

Humidity
As a tropical plant, the Epipremnum Pinnatum Albo Variegated Cebu Blue prefers high humidity levels. Aim for a humidity level of 60% or higher. If your home has low humidity, consider using a humidifier or placing the plant on a pebble tray filled with water to increase moisture around the plant.

Fertilizer
During the growing season, feed your plant with a balanced, water-soluble fertilizer every 4-6 weeks. This will provide the necessary nutrients for robust growth. Fertilization can be reduced or halted during the dormant winter months when the plant’s growth naturally slows.

Toxicity
The Epipremnum Pinnatum Albo Variegated Cebu Blue is toxic if ingested by pets or humans. It contains calcium oxalate crystals, which can cause irritation to the mouth, throat, and digestive tract. It’s important to keep this plant out of reach of children and pets.
